LOUISVILLE, Ky. — It’s a record-setting day at Churchill Downs, where the biggest crowd on record has turned out to watch the 137th Kentucky Derby.
The track says 164,858 people crammed into the Louisville track on Saturday to watch the Run for the Roses. That beats the previous record crowd of 163,628 in 1974.
Saturday began with forecasts of scattered rain showers, but as the big race approached the crowd was basking in a mild, sun-splashed late afternoon.
